SO CUTE :O Farming and pokemon, my two favorite things. Looking good so far!

some things that came to mind from my playtime:

It took me a minute to figure out how to use the potato seeds, I eventually figured out how to put them on the hot bar, not sure if you can use items from your bag

It would be nice if when you just tapped the direction keys once, your character would face that direction instead of moving. Made positioning to water my potatoes awfully annoying

Things like the axe should continuously activate if you hold down the button imo

Character gets stuck in walking animation if moving while talking to someone, woops

Would be nice if trees/other obstacles faded out when you're behind them so I can see what the heck I'm stuck on

I couldn't catch a single fish ;---;

being able to sit down is ADORABLE!

I like how the battles take place in the overworld instead of a vs screen! But sometimes the creatures are hidden behind environment details like trees D: There was some neat mushroom creature I could barely see 

Needs an exit game button!

The art for this game is BOMB AS HECK I love the lil character guy and his gun is very snappy & responsive, it's fun how you can shoot it in a full arc instead of just to the left or right. The background is completely beautiful and creates a great atmosphere :D It's challenging and I personally appreciate that a lot in a game, don't want to just roll through something too easily after all; I had to learn to be predictive with the speed of gunfire vs the enemies. Pushing the blocks around for a jumping off point was a cool mechanic.

some bugs I think I found: I got killed by the first big jellyfish boss guy and when I hit "try again" and went through the level again, the boss did not spawn after the little jellyfishes came down to attack me; after a few restarts I deduced that the reason was that I, being the wily player I am, kept skipping the first sluggy guy after my first playthrough afterI realized you could hop onto the block above it, and it *seems* that failing to defeat all previous monsters in the level prevents the boss from spawning - but also, once you are in the boss area you aren't allowed to go back and shoot any enemies you missed, so you have to start all over. Also, I wish I could give more thorough feedback about this, but I wasn't able to pinpoint exactly when it was happening D:, but double jump seemed to not trigger for me sometimes, very random when it wouldn't but I wonder if it could have something to do with the way I constantly press A or D while I am also trying to double jump. I dunno! At first I thought I might be trying to trigger it too fast, but I noticed some fails even when I gave it time to cool down.
